Evenepoel Abandons Tour De France

HAUTES-PYRÉNÉES, FRANCE, JUL 19 – Remco Evenepoel abandoned the 2025 Tour de France during Stage 14 after struggling with poor form linked to a December 2024 crash, causing a major shakeup in the general classification.

  • During the 182.6-km Pyrenean trek, Remco Evenepoel abandoned Stage 14 on the Col du Tourmalet, feeling 'empty' and struggling in the mountains.
  • After a disrupted preparation, Remco Evenepoel, Belgian rider, struggled early on the Tourmalet, hindering his performance and leading to his withdrawal.
  • In a poignant moment, Remco Evenepoel handed his water bottle to a young roadside spectator, then climbed into his Soudal Quick-Step team car and withdrew from the race.
  • In the GC battle, the abandonment reshuffled the general classification standings, removing Evenepoel from third place and allowing Florian Lipowitz to inherit the white jersey and move into third overall.
  • Looking ahead to July 27’s Paris finish, the Tour de France now heads there without one of its brightest talents, leaving the GC duel between Pogacar and Vingegaard more uncertain.
